Vehicle fire reported on Route 24 near Kingston Mines, Kingston Mines IL
A red Ford Ranger was reported on fire while moving eastbound on Route 24 near Kingston Mines, Illinois. Multiple fire units were dispatched to locate and respond to the vehicle fire as it continued traveling.
